PERSONAL COMMUNICATION FOR AS/400 ------------------------------- If you are using Personal Communication (PCCOMM) as your choice of 5250 emulation software, then it is recommended that you get the latest software upgrades, APAR or Corrective Service Diskettes, for PCCOMM. The required APARs should be references as shown below: IC14957 (Version 4.1 Combo-Win) IC14958 (Version 4.1 PC400-Win) IC14959 (Version 4.1 Combo-W95) IC14960 (Version 4.1 PC400-W95) 2. UPGRADING YOUR BIOS ------------------------------- If you are experiencing problems getting a host connection with the 5250 PCI adapter and you have an IBM PC with the PCI support interface. Then upgrading yourPC's BIOS may solve your problem. You can find the date of your system's BIOS going into System Setup, when you boot your PC. You can look on the Internet to see if there is a later version for your PC. The IBM File Library WEB site that has the latest BIOS upgrade filesis located at: www.pc.ibm.com/listfiles.html From here you can search for your specific IBM PC. If there is a flash BIOS upgrade date later than on your PC, then download the file to your PC and follow the instructions that comes with the file. 3. TECHNICAL SUPPORT ------------------------------- Installation and Technical support, including problem diagnosis and resolution, is provided by the IBM 5250 Emulation Support Center in Charlotte, North Carolina. This support is accessed in call back mode through the IBM Support Center. In the United States, you may call the IBM Support Center at 1-800-237-5511 anytime and receive a return call within eight business hours (Monday -Friday, 8:30 a.m. - 5:00 p.m, eastern time). If you get an automated response when you call the IBM Support Center, select the AS/400 option. The emulation program does not rwequire a support contract. The IBM Support Technical Support center also maintains a Bulletin board (BBS), that contains tips, user information, and program updates. The BBS is available 24 hours a day. You can call the IBM 5250 Technical Support Center BBS at 704-594-3799 anytime using the asynchronous modem. The BBS supports communications up to 14.4KB with 8 bits, no parity, and one stop bit.
